> Can you tell me what is the DC power voltage of this power source & max
> current or wattage?

It's ~15V at up to ~75W in most cases. See more here:
http://www.seatguru.com/articles/in-seat_laptop_power.php

If you walk into a Frys or CompUSA and purchase a Targus or iGo "automobile"
power adapter for your laptop, it'll most likely be usable with the Empower
connector as well: The 12V cigarette lighter plug snaps onto the Empower plug.
(Check out their web sites for more info as well.)

> Can I use it to charge laptop and cell phone and use for portable DVD
> players?

Yes.

> Is this power source for all domestic and international airlines?

No, of course not.
